ORLANDO, Fla. — When 49ers coach Kyle Shanahan decided to fire defensive coordinator Steve Wilks two days after the team's Super Bowl loss, he already knew who was going to replace him. Nick Sorensen was the guy. And Shanahan did not need the formality of an interview to be convinced. Sorensen joined the 49ers' coaching staff in 2022 in the nebulous title of defensive assistant. Last year, Sorensen was promoted to defensive passing game/nickels coach. He also spoke to the team every Thursday with an emphasis on excelling in the takeaway/giveaway column. When asked what he heard from Sorensen that he liked, Shanahan said it was the culmination of being around him the past two seasons. "I've been with him the last two years, mainly," Shanahan said. "When you're with somebody, it's not really an interview that changes it, it's being with somebody in the building every day. "I thought he was close last year to being ready, and I think he's even more ready now."Sorensen, 45, will assume standard defensive coordinator responsibilities of being in charge of organizing the game plan and calling the defense during games.
